The state of Maine is seeking a qualified vendor to provide an enterprise-class Integrated Workplace Management System (IWMS). This new system will replace the current AiM (AssetWorks) solution and is expected to deliver comprehensive functionality for managing workplace operations across the enterprise.
The desired IWMS must be fully web-based, accessible via mobile devices, and offer high configurability to meet the state's dynamic requirements. It should integrate seamlessly with existing enterprise systems and support modern security standards, including SSO protocols such as SAML 2.0 and OpenID Connect. Multi-factor authentication (MFA) must also be enforced for administrator and privileged user accounts.
